With this product in your home, you have everything you need to start your own workout program, to
tone and strengthen the important muscle groups of your upper and lower body. This is vital for all of us,
regardless of age, sex, or fitness level, and regardless of whether your primary goal is body sculpting,
weight loss, health maintenance, or more energy for daily activities.
Strength training not only tones and conditions the muscles we use every day to stand, walk, lift, and
turn; it can actually transform our body composition. By reducing body fat and increasing the proportion
of lean muscle in our bodies, strength training can effectively turn up our metabolic thermostat, so that
we burn calories all the time, no matter what we’re doing.
It’s easy-all you have to do is spend 15 to 20 minutes a day, 3 to 4 days per week on your Total Gym®
Shaper to start realizing the benefits.

INSPECTION, MAINTENANCE & STORAGE
%"&I*!'$&!&*D%"$"$!$I&!II'%
Before using your Total Gym®Shaper for your workout session, be sure to make the
following inspection:
• ake sure the equipment is fully opened and sitting on a solid, level surface with plenty of
clearance on all sides. Unit should be used on a mat or on carpeted surfaces only.
• ake sure all the Pins are securely in place and locked into position.
• Check that the Pulley is attached securely to the loop on the top underside of
the Glideboard.
• Check that the Cable is traveling correctly in the groove of each Pulley.
• ake sure the Cable is securely fastened to each Handle.
• Check that the Leg Pull/Press Up Attachment or other accessories are installed
correctly when in use.
• ake sure the Glideboard is gliding smoothly along the Rails.
$!'& &
•Wipe down your Total Gym®Shaper on a regular basis using a clean cloth and alcohol or
alcohol-based products like Windex®or 409®. Do not leave towels or workout clothing
laying or hanging on the equipment.
• Periodically check the following parts for signs of fraying or other wear: the Cable, Pulleys,
Wheels, Glideboard, accessories and Rails. If the Cable, Pulleys, Rails or Wheels need
replaced – do not use your unit, wait until the part is replaced. If any other part than the
ones listed above needs to be replaced, do not use that part until it is replaced.
• Never use a lubricant such as WD-40®or ArmorAll®to lubricate or clean the unit. Use only
3-in-1®oil or machine oil to lubricate the axles of the wheel or pulley, not the roller surface.

STARTING OUT
Wear athletic shoes and comfortable light clothing when exercising on the Total Gym®Shaper. Do
not exercise barefoot. Check your exerciser before using to ensure that all the parts are in place
and working properly
(see pages 10 & 11 for details on Inspection, aintenance and Storage).
.?6>=?:/<@3=3983=</;?3</.+>+66>37/=
NOTE: The Rails and Glideboard can be raised to any desired level on the Vertical Colu n
depending upon your degree of fitness. Please note, however, that the Rails cannot
be raised to the highest position on the Vertical Colu n when the Leg Pulley
Bracket is attached to the colu n. Be sure you have plenty of free space around
the exerciser so that perfor ing on the Total Gy ®Shaper, as well as getting on
and off, is convenient and safe.
Each time you raise or lower the Height Adjustment Assembly, be sure you hold it to keep
it from dropping to the floor.
Begin using the product at a low incline. As your fitness level progresses, increase the incline to
increase the intensity and improve your muscle strength. Don’t be in a hurry to exercise at a high
intensity level; start out easily and build gradually. The Total Gym®Shaper is as easy as 1-2-3
to use, so read on.

HOW TO ATTACH THE LEG PULLEY ACCESSORY KIT (OPTIONAL
1. Connect the Leg Pulley Bracket to the top of the Vertical Column by
aligning Bracket with the hole at the top of the column. (Be sure
Bracket is right side up.) Insert Long Hitch Pin through the hole to
secure Bracket onto the Vertical Column (See Fig. 1).
2. Detach the Cable Assembly from the loop on the underside of the
Glideboard and attach one of the Clips from the Leg Pulley Assembly.
3. Place D-Ring on Pulley first. Then connect the D-Ring to the
Bracket as shown. (See Fig. 2)
NOTE: If Rope appears to be twisted, take D-Ring off and turn
Pulley around.
4Attach the Foot Harness to one of your feet by placing your foot in
the Harness so the sewn-in-ring is on the bottom of your foot.
Pull tightly on the belt so the Harness is secure. (See Fig. 3)
5(a) Position yourself on the Glideboard correctly for the specific
exercise you want to perform.
(b) While lying down on the Glideboard, connect the Clip on
the end of the Rope to an O-Ring on the Harness attached
to your foot. (See Fig 4) Depending on the exercise you are
performing, connect the Clip to the proper O-Ring. Be sure to
always stabilize the Glideboard when clipping the Harness on or
off. Also, use caution when getting on or off the Glideboard. You
are now ready to exercise using the Leg Pulley Accessory.
See your
Exercise Guide
for specific exercises that utilize the
Leg Pulley Accessory.

HOW TO ATTACH THE LEG PULL/PRESS UP ATTACHMENT
The Leg Pull/Press Up Attachment provided with your unit has been uniquely designed to serve
several purposes. It can be placed at the top or bottom of the exerciser and angled toward you or
away from you depending upon what is comfortable for you.
Two thick Foam Pads are provided with the Leg Pull/Press Up Attachment. They must be attached to
the Attachment (if not already) before exercising. To do this:
1. Simply wet each end of the straight crossbar with
soapy water.
2. Attach Foam Pads on the crossbar as shown
in Figure 1. Let dry before beginning to exercise
with the Leg Pull/Press Up Attachment.
Pro er ways to use the Leg Pull/Press U Attachment in
accordance with the exercises you wish to do:
"''"%
1. Locate the holes at the top of the Right and Left Rails on
the column end of the unit.
2. With the Attachment angled >9A+<. the Glideboard, line up
the Brackets on the Attachment with the desired position
holes on the Rails.
3. Insert the 2 Short Hitch Pins through the holes on the
Leg Pull/Press Up Attachment Brackets and the hole on
the Rails, as shown in Figure 2.
4. You are now ready to perform pull up and chin up exercises to
work the arms, lats and back. See your
Exercise Booklet
for
specific exercises.
"'$' %% %&'"%
1. Locate the holes at the top of the Right and Left Rails on
the column end of the unit.
2. With the Attachment angled +A+C0<97 the Glideboard,
line up the Brackets on the Attachment with the desired
position holes on the Rails.
3. Insert the 2 Short Hitch Pins through the holes on the
Leg Pull/Press Up Attachment Brackets and the hole on
the Rails, as shown in Figure 3.
4. You are now ready to perform leg pulls, crunches and sit up
exercises to work the abdominals, waist and legs. See your
Exercise Booklet
for specific exercises.
